What is 5083 H116 Aluminum Plate?
5083 H116 is a non-heat-treatable aluminum-magnesium alloy that has been strain-hardened and specially processed for marine environments. The H116 temper ensures high strength and enhanced resistance to corrosion in freshwater and saltwater conditions.

5083 Plate Mechanical Properties (Typical – H116)
| Property | Value |
|---|---|
| Tensile Strength | 275 – 350 MPa |
| Yield Strength | ≥ 240 MPa |
| Elongation | ≥ 10% |
| Brinell Hardness | ~75 HB |
| Density | 2.66 g/cm³ |
5083 Plate Chemical Composition (% Max)
| Element | % Content |
|---|---|
| Magnesium (Mg) | 4.0 – 4.9 |
| Manganese (Mn) | 0.4 – 1.0 |
| Chromium (Cr) | 0.05 – 0.25 |
| Iron (Fe) | ≤ 0.40 |
| Silicon (Si) | ≤ 0.40 |
| Copper (Cu) | ≤ 0.10 |
| Zinc (Zn) | ≤ 0.25 |
| Aluminum (Al) | Balance |
Aluminum 5083 Plate applications
- Shipbuilding – hull plating, decks, bulkheads
- Offshore platforms – walkways, enclosures, load-bearing components
- Cryogenic tanks – LNG and low-temperature containers
- Chemical storage tanks – due to high corrosion resistance
- Military and naval crafts – patrol boats, armor plating
- Structural marine applications – ramps, superstructures, boat trailers

What is the difference between 5083 H116 and 5083 H321?
- H116: Strain-hardened and specially treated for marine applications, with superior corrosion resistance.
- H321: Also strain-hardened, but thermally stabilized for higher temperature service.
Both are marine-grade, but H116 is generally preferred for direct seawater exposure.
Is 5083 H116 aluminum plate weldable?
Yes. It is easily weldable using conventional methods like MIG and TIG welding. Post-weld strength and corrosion resistance remain excellent, which is why it’s preferred in marine fabrications.
